About The Position

The Mission of the Public Defender's Office is to provide complete, quality legal representation to indigent defendants who are faced with a possible jail sentence and are charged with a municipal ordinance violation in the Aurora Municipal Court. The Public Defender's Office is governed by the Public Defender Commission, which ensures that indigent clients are represented in accordance with its strict guidelines. Under the direction of the Chief Public defender, provides professional legal counsel to and defends indigent clients in cases brought before the Municipal Court.

Responsibilities

  • Represents indigent defendants in cases brought before the municipal court charged with municipal ordinance violations in the Aurora Municipal Court
  • Examines evidence, reviews, prepares, and presents cases.
  • Counsels’ clients on legal rights and responsibilities
  • Initiates and defends appeals in appellate courts, when appropriate
  • Works on numerous trials and hearings, client interviews, motions, and/or appeals
  • Works with court staff to see that cases are handled in an efficient and timely manner.
  • Follows established court procedures.
  • Performs additional duties as assigned by the Chief Public Defender or Chief Deputy Public Defender
